Singer Lance Bass targeted with series of anti-gay messages, threats

Openly gay entertainer Lance Bass was the target of a series of anti-gay slurs, sent to him in a series of Facebook messages on Saturday.

The remarks, by a user named “Ted Fau,” contained several anti-gay slurs, and threatened Bass with this comment, “I want to stab you and play around with your blood.”

Bass tweeted this image of the comments from his iPhone yesterday, with the message, “If I go missing, this guy did it.”

Another threat among the messages was that gangsters “have a hit on you.”

The user “Ted Fau” was unable to be located on Facebook on Tuesday.
